How Outpatient Drug and Alcohol Rehab Works in Thompson Ridge, New York

If you have been grappling with a severe substance use disorder and addiction, outpatient drug and alcohol treatment may not prove suitable for you. Before you seek treatment for your addiction, you must first go through detoxification to rid your body completely of the substances you were abusing.

After the detox stage, the outpatient addiction treatment will start the official work of therapy and recovery. In fact, these programs work best if you have already completed another form of care - such as a staying in an inpatient drug and alcohol rehab center. You should also be deemed medically stable enough that you can comfortably pursue treatment and recovery with little to no supervision.

When you enroll in an outpatient drug and alcohol treatment facility in Thompson Ridge, the following services will be provided every week:

  • Family counseling
  • Group therapy and support meetings
  • One-on-one counseling
  • Medication management, which might be required if you have a co-occurring disorder or have been diagnosed with polysubstance addiction
  • Nutritional coaching
  • One on one therapy sessions with licensed treatment counselors
  • Recreational therapy
  • Relapse prevention
  • Transitional living

Since outpatient rehabilitation does not demand that you reside inside the center, it means that you may need to dedicate yourself to sobriety so that the program proves worthwhile in the long run. You should also aim for sobriety and abstain from drugs without any supervision or assistance.

As long as your environment is conducive to your recovery, you may find that outpatient drug and alcohol rehabilitation is the best option. This is because you will get help and assistance at home so that you can continue focusing on overcoming your addiction - with none of the temptations you may have encountered in the past.

Like many Community Action Agencies, RECAP traces its roots to Lyndon Johnson's presidency. When President Johnson took office in 1963, he proclaimed that all Americans could live in prosperity and thought to accomplish this through reform.In his 1964 State of the Union Address, Johnson declared an unconditional war on America's poverty and challenged citizens to build a 'Great Society.' Organizations were established and they developed a model, the Community Action Program, that could eradicate poverty from the ground up. This model gave people the power to identify problems affecting their own communities and the resources to bring change.
